Facial machines have gained traction in the beauty and skincare industry, particularly in China, which holds a significant market share. These devices typically incorporate a range of technologies, such as microcurrent therapy, ultrasonic waves, and LED light therapy. Microcurrent therapy uses low-level electrical currents to stimulate facial muscles, promoting a lifted appearance. Reports indicate this technique can increase collagen production, leading to smoother skin.
Ultrasonic technology operates by emitting sound waves that penetrate the skin layers. This stimulates cellular activity and improves blood circulation. A well-cited study in the Journal of Cosmetic Dermatology suggests that patients have noted a 32% increase in skin elasticity after consistent ultrasonic treatments over six weeks. LED light therapy offers another dimension, where different wavelengths target various skin concerns. Research from the American Academy of Dermatology supports its effectiveness in reducing acne and hyperpigmentation.
